On 3 June 2026, from 10:00 to 12:30, BIO4EEB will participate in the RECAP Cluster hybrid event entitled “Closing the Loop: Advancing EU Competitiveness and Sustainability through AI, Robotics, and Digital Twins in the Manufacturing Sector.”
Held online, the session will bring together five EU-funded projects: CompSTLar, BIO4EEB, ICARUS, iBot4CRMs, and Wood2Wood. The event will explore how artificial intelligence, robotics, digital twins, digitalisation, and advanced sorting technologies can help strengthen circularity across several high-impact sectors.
Technological solutions supporting circularity
The event will highlight innovative solutions aimed at improving resource efficiency, reducing waste, recovering secondary materials, and optimising material lifecycles.
Discussions will cover several key sectors, including aerospace, the built environment, and industrial manufacturing. Particular attention will also be given to the sustainable valorisation of composites, industrial waste, critical raw materials, and wood.
Through expert presentations, the session will show how advanced technologies can help accelerate the transition towards a greener and more resilient industrial economy while supporting European competitiveness.
BIO4EEB’s contribution to the agenda
As part of the programme, BIO4EEB will present:
“Demonstrating Circular and Bio-Based Insulation Materials for Enhancing the Energy Performance of Buildings.”
The presentation will be delivered by Fernando Sigchos Jimenez, Secretary General of EBC.
The event is open to policymakers and regulatory bodies, researchers and academic institutions, industry professionals in manufacturing, aerospace, and construction, as well as stakeholders involved in digital innovation, automation, and the circular economy.
